VIDEO: My relatives did dɤʋgs, they linked me to it but I refused – Ken Agyapong explains dɤʋg allegations

Ghanaian politician and businessman Kennedy Ohene Agyapong has revealed that he was linked into drugs but he removed to get his hands dirty.

In a 2015 video which has resurfaced on the internet the Assin Central Member of Parliament was quizzed by journalist Nana Aba Anamoah on whether he’s a drug dealer as alleged by some people.

He answered that he has never done drugs and that he is a genuine businessman who worked hard to be successful.

The Assin Central MP then said he will go blunt if the journalist wants and that was when he made a statement that “about 85% of successful businessmen in the country one way or the other dealt in drugs”.

Hon. Kennedy Agyapong added he’s never peddled drugs but “as for relatives yes, my relatives they’ve done it then they linked me to it but there are evidences there to show that I was not part of it because certain actions I took when you go there have the police record there”.

 

Nana Aba Anamoah then asked if he is friends to these drug dealers and he said he wouldn’t know because the person could be his friend but wouldn’t tell him what he does and he doesn’t poke his nose into people’s business.
